June is for planting...

and sending in your planting report forms, along with documentation for all the sources of seed, seedlings or clones planted, including Certificate of Analyses demonstrating that you are growing hemp. The report forms are on the hemp web page. This paperwork is due 14 days after planting. If you have any questions, please contact Mary at 207-441-1643 or mary.yurlina@maine.gov  

National Credit Union Administration provides updated guidance

New memo provides answers to 17 questions that will help legal hemp growers and entrepreneurs gain access to financial services. For more information read Additional Guidance Regarding Servicing Hemp-Related Businesses.
